Description

4-Ethynyl-2-Fluorobenzenamine is a high-purity fluorinated aniline derivative featuring a reactive ethynyl group. This compound is a critical pharmaceutical intermediate and organic building block used in the synthesis of complex molecules. It is primarily utilized by R&D laboratories and production facilities in the pharmaceutical, agrochemical, and advanced materials sectors for constructing novel chemical entities.

Application

  • Pharmaceutical Intermediate: Key building block in the synthesis of active pharmaceutical ingredients (APIs), particularly for kinase inhibitors and other targeted therapies.
  • Agrochemical Synthesis: Used in the research and development of novel herbicides and pesticides, leveraging the fluorine atom for enhanced biological activity.
  • Material Science: Serves as a monomer or cross-linking agent in the development of specialty polymers and advanced organic electronic materials.
  • Chemical Research: A versatile reagent in organic synthesis, including Sonogashira coupling and other palladium-catalyzed reactions, due to its terminal alkyne functionality.
  • Ligand Precursor: Used in the preparation of specialized ligands for catalysis and metal-organic frameworks (MOFs).
  • Fluorine Chemistry Studies: An important compound for studying structure-activity relationships (SAR) in medicinal chemistry and the effects of fluorine substitution.

Basic Information

Product Name 4-Ethynyl-2-Fluorobenzenamine
CAS No. 1008112-39-7
Molecular Formula C8H6FN
Molecular Weight 135.14 g/mol
Synonyms 2-Fluoro-4-ethynylaniline; 4-Amino-3-fluorophenylacetylene; 4-Ethynyl-2-fluoroaniline; 2-Fluoro-4-ethynylbenzenamine; 3-Fluoro-4-aminophenylacetylene; 4-Ethynyl-2-fluorophenylamine; Benzenamine, 4-ethynyl-2-fluoro-

Storage

Preserve in a tightly closed container, protected from light. Store under an inert atmosphere (e.g., nitrogen or argon) in a cool, dry, and well-ventilated area at room temperature (15-25°C). This material is easily oxidized and light-sensitive.
